CC -!- FUNCTION: Part of the gene cluster that mediates the biosynthesis of
CC lolitrems, indole-diterpene mycotoxins that are potent tremorgens in
CC mammals, and are synthesized by clavicipitaceous fungal endophytes in
CC association with their grass hosts (PubMed:23468653). The
CC geranylgeranyl diphosphate (GGPP) synthase ltmG is proposed to catalyze
CC the first step in lolitrem biosynthesis (PubMed:16765617,
CC PubMed:15991026). LtmG catalyzes a series of iterative condensations of
CC isopentenyl diphosphate (IPP) with dimethylallyl diphosphate (DMAPP),
CC geranyl diphosphate (GPP), and farnesyl diphosphate (FPP), to form GGPP
CC (PubMed:16765617, PubMed:15991026). GGPP then condenses with indole-3-
CC glycerol phosphate to form 3-geranylgeranylindole, an acyclic
CC intermediate, to be incorporated into paxilline (PubMed:16765617).
CC Either ltmG or ltmC could be responsible for this step, as both are
CC putative prenyl transferases (PubMed:16765617). The FAD-dependent
CC monooxygenase ltmM then catalyzes the epoxidation of the two terminal
CC alkenes of the geranylgeranyl moiety, which is subsequently cyclized by
CC ltmB, to paspaline (PubMed:16765617, PubMed:15991026). The cytochrome
CC P450 monooxygenases ltmQ and ltmP can sequentially oxidize paspaline to
CC terpendole E and terpendole F (PubMed:22750140). Alternatively, ltmP
CC converts paspaline to an intermediate which is oxidized by ltmQ to
CC terpendole F (PubMed:22750140). LtmF, ltmK, ltmE and ltmJ appear to be
CC unique to the epichloe endophytes (PubMed:16765617, PubMed:15991026).
CC The prenyltransferase ltmF is involved in the 27-hydroxyl-O-prenylation
CC (PubMed:22750140). The cytochrome P450 monooxygenase ltmK is required
CC for the oxidative acetal ring formation (PubMed:22750140). The multi-
CC functional prenyltransferase ltmE is required for C20- and C21-
CC prenylations of the indole ring of paspalanes and acts together with
CC the cytochrome P450 monooxygenase ltmJ to yield lolitremanes by
CC multiple oxidations and ring closures (PubMed:22750140). The
CC stereoisomer pairs of lolitriol and lolitrem N or lolitrem B and
CC lolitrem F may be attributed to variations in the way in which ring
CC closure can occur under the action of ltmJ (PubMed:22750140). While the
CC major product of this pathway is lolitrem B, the prenyl transferases
CC and cytochrome P450 monooxygenases identified in this pathway have a
CC remarkable versatility in their regio- and stereo-specificities to
CC generate a diverse range of metabolites that are products of a
CC metabolic grid rather than a linear pathway (PubMed:22750140).
